Biography
Veteran forward played in 230 grade games for St George, winning premierships in all three grades (1974, 1976 & 1977). Stone was graded as a 17-year-old lock in 1974 and made his first grade debut the following year. Not spared the humiliating 38-0 defeat by Easts in the 1975 grand final, he later won a premiership in reserve grade in 1976 and was an important part of 'Bath's Babes' who won the title in 1977. A fierce competitor, Stone romped away to score the first try in the replay against P’matta and was part of a pack that punished their opponents with unchecked aggression. Stone later moved to prop and was a replacement forward in the inaugural State of Origin match in 1980. Stone’s career fluctuated between the grades in the mid-1980s and he took on a captain-coach position with Picton. Stone returned to the St George club in an administrative role before losing a courageous battle with cancer in 2005.
- ALAN WHITICKER
